diff --git a/Cargo.lock b/Cargo.lock index e5957338..d9cbade6 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-1076,7 +1076,7 @@ version = "2.2.1"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"e0c17d606a298a205fae325489fbed88ee6dc4463c111672172327e741c8905d" dependencies = [ - "solana-program-error", + "solana-program-error 2.2.2", "solana-program-memory", "solana-pubkey", ] @@ -1131,7 +1131,7 @@ dependencies = [ "solana-account-info", "solana-define-syscall 2.2.1", "solana-instruction", - "solana-program-error", + "solana-program-error 2.2.2", "solana-pubkey", "solana-stable-layout", ] @@ -1263,7 +1263,7 @@ dependencies = [ "bitflags", "solana-account-info", "solana-instruction", - "solana-program-error", + "solana-program-error 2.2.2", "solana-pubkey", "solana-sanitize", "solana-sdk-ids", @@ -1316,7 +1316,7 @@ checksum = "473ffe73c68d93e9f2aa726ad2985fe52760052709aaab188100a42c618060ec" dependencies = [ "solana-account-info", "solana-msg 2.2.1", - "solana-program-error", + "solana-program-error 2.2.2", "solana-pubkey", ] @@ -1334,6 +1334,15 @@ dependencies = [ "solana-pubkey", ] +[[package]] +name = "solana-program-error" +version = "3.0.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"a1af32c995a7b692a915bb7414d5f8e838450cf7c70414e763d8abcae7b51f28" +dependencies = [ + "borsh 1.5.7", +] + [[package]] name = "solana-program-memory" version = "2.2.1" @@ -1356,7 +1365,7 @@ version = "2.2.1"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"319f0ef15e6e12dc37c597faccb7d62525a509fec5f6975ecb9419efddeb277b" dependencies = [ - "solana-program-error", + "solana-program-error 2.2.2", ] [[package]] @@ -1544,7 +1553,7 @@ dependencies = [ "solana-cpi", "solana-decode-error", "solana-instruction", - "solana-program-error", + "solana-program-error 2.2.2", "solana-pubkey", "solana-system-interface", "solana-sysvar-id", @@ -1588,7 +1597,7 @@ dependencies = [ "solana-instructions-sysvar", "solana-last-restart-slot", "solana-program-entrypoint", - "solana-program-error", + "solana-program-error 2.2.2", "solana-program-memory", "solana-pubkey", "solana-rent", @@ -1699,7 +1708,7 @@ version = "0.4.1" dependencies = [ "borsh 1.5.7", "bytemuck", - "solana-program-error", + "solana-program-error 3.0.0", "solana-sha256-hasher", "spl-discriminator 0.4.1", "spl-discriminator-derive 0.2.0", @@ -1712,7 +1721,7 @@ source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"a7398da23554a31660f17718164e31d31900956054f54f52d5ec1be51cb4f4b3" dependencies = [ "bytemuck", - "solana-program-error", + "solana-program-error 2.2.2", "solana-sha256-hasher", "spl-discriminator-derive 0.2.0 (registry+https://github.com/rust-lang/crates.io-index)", ] @@ -1773,7 +1782,7 @@ dependencies = [ "solana-instruction", "solana-msg 2.2.1", "solana-program-entrypoint", - "solana-program-error", + "solana-program-error 2.2.2", "solana-pubkey", "solana-rent", "solana-sdk-ids", @@ -1815,7 +1824,7 @@ dependencies = [ "solana-instruction", "solana-msg 2.2.1", "solana-program-entrypoint", - "solana-program-error", + "solana-program-error 2.2.2", "solana-pubkey", ] @@ -1832,7 +1841,7 @@ dependencies = [ "num-traits", "solana-decode-error", "solana-msg 2.2.1", - "solana-program-error", + "solana-program-error 2.2.2", "solana-program-option", "solana-pubkey", "solana-zk-sdk 2.3.6", @@ -1852,7 +1861,7 @@ dependencies = [ "num_enum", "serde", "serde_json", - "solana-program-error", + "solana-program-error 3.0.0", "solana-program-option", "solana-pubkey", "solana-zk-sdk 3.0.0", @@ -1870,7 +1879,7 @@ dependencies = [ "serial_test", "solana-decode-error", "solana-msg 3.0.0", - "solana-program-error", + "solana-program-error 3.0.0", "solana-sha256-hasher", "solana-sysvar", "spl-program-error-derive 0.5.0", @@ -1887,7 +1896,7 @@ dependencies = [ "num-traits", "solana-decode-error", "solana-msg 2.2.1", - "solana-program-error", + "solana-program-error 2.2.2", "spl-program-error-derive 0.5.0 (registry+https://github.com/rust-lang/crates.io-index)", "thiserror 2.0.12", ] @@ -1928,7 +1937,7 @@ dependencies = [ "solana-account-info", "solana-decode-error", "solana-instruction", - "solana-program-error", + "solana-program-error 3.0.0", "solana-pubkey", "spl-discriminator 0.4.1", "spl-pod 0.6.0", @@ -1951,7 +1960,7 @@ dependencies = [ "solana-decode-error", "solana-instruction", "solana-msg 2.2.1", - "solana-program-error", + "solana-program-error 2.2.2", "solana-pubkey", "spl-discriminator 0.4.1 (registry+https://github.com/rust-lang/crates.io-index)", "spl-pod 0.5.1", @@ -1977,7 +1986,7 @@ dependencies = [ "solana-instruction", "solana-msg 2.2.1", "solana-program-entrypoint", - "solana-program-error", + "solana-program-error 2.2.2", "solana-program-memory", "solana-program-option", "solana-program-pack", @@ -2007,7 +2016,7 @@ dependencies = [ "solana-msg 2.2.1", "solana-native-token", "solana-program-entrypoint", - "solana-program-error", + "solana-program-error 2.2.2", "solana-program-memory", "solana-program-option", "solana-program-pack", @@ -2056,7 +2065,7 @@ dependencies = [ "solana-instruction", "solana-instructions-sysvar", "solana-msg 2.2.1", - "solana-program-error", + "solana-program-error 2.2.2", "solana-pubkey", "solana-sdk-ids", "solana-zk-sdk 2.3.6", @@ -2087,7 +2096,7 @@ dependencies = [ "solana-decode-error", "solana-instruction", "solana-msg 2.2.1", - "solana-program-error", + "solana-program-error 2.2.2", "solana-pubkey", "spl-discriminator 0.4.1 (registry+https://github.com/rust-lang/crates.io-index)", "spl-pod 0.5.1", @@ -2107,7 +2116,7 @@ dependencies = [ "solana-decode-error", "solana-instruction", "solana-msg 2.2.1", - "solana-program-error", + "solana-program-error 2.2.2", "solana-pubkey", "spl-discriminator 0.4.1 (registry+https://github.com/rust-lang/crates.io-index)", "spl-pod 0.5.1", @@ -2130,7 +2139,7 @@ dependencies = [ "solana-decode-error", "solana-instruction", "solana-msg 2.2.1", - "solana-program-error", + "solana-program-error 2.2.2", "solana-pubkey", "spl-discriminator 0.4.1 (registry+https://github.com/rust-lang/crates.io-index)", "spl-pod 0.5.1", @@ -2151,7 +2160,7 @@ dependencies = [ "solana-account-info", "solana-decode-error", "solana-msg 3.0.0", - "solana-program-error", + "solana-program-error 3.0.0", "spl-discriminator 0.4.1", "spl-pod 0.6.0", "spl-type-length-value-derive", @@ -2170,7 +2179,7 @@ dependencies = [ "solana-account-info", "solana-decode-error", "solana-msg 2.2.1", - "solana-program-error", + "solana-program-error 2.2.2", "spl-discriminator 0.4.1 (registry+https://github.com/rust-lang/crates.io-index)", "spl-pod 0.5.1", "thiserror 2.0.12", diff --git a/discriminator/Cargo.toml b/discriminator/Cargo.toml index 564fa194..3501c50a 100644 --- a/discriminator/Cargo.toml +++ b/discriminator/Cargo.toml @@ -13,7 +13,7 @@ borsh = ["dep:borsh"] [dependencies] borsh = { version = "1", optional = true, features = ["derive"] } bytemuck = { version = "1.23.2", features = ["derive"] } -solana-program-error = "2.2.2" +solana-program-error = "3.0.0" solana-sha256-hasher = "2.3.0" spl-discriminator-derive = { version = "0.2.0", path = "./derive" } diff --git a/pod/Cargo.toml b/pod/Cargo.toml index 92944900..ff8b835b 100644 --- a/pod/Cargo.toml +++ b/pod/Cargo.toml @@ -19,7 +19,7 @@ num-derive = "0.4" num_enum = "0.7" num-traits = "0.2" serde = { version = "1.0.219", optional = true } -solana-program-error = "2.2.2" +solana-program-error = "3.0.0" solana-program-option = "2.2.1" solana-pubkey = "2.2.1" solana-zk-sdk = "3.0.0" diff --git a/program-error/Cargo.toml b/program-error/Cargo.toml index a2535fc7..de2640db 100644 --- a/program-error/Cargo.toml +++ b/program-error/Cargo.toml @@ -13,7 +13,7 @@ num_enum = "0.7" num-traits = "0.2" solana-decode-error = "2.2.1" solana-msg = "3.0.0" -solana-program-error = "2.2.2" +solana-program-error = "3.0.0" spl-program-error-derive = { version = "0.5.0", path = "./derive" } thiserror = "2.0" diff --git a/tlv-account-resolution/Cargo.toml b/tlv-account-resolution/Cargo.toml index 5ea138be..14133df3 100644 --- a/tlv-account-resolution/Cargo.toml +++ b/tlv-account-resolution/Cargo.toml @@ -19,7 +19,7 @@ serde = { version = "1.0.219", optional = true } solana-account-info = "2.2.1" solana-decode-error = "2.2.1" solana-instruction = { version = "2.2.1", features = ["std"] } -solana-program-error = "2.2.2" +solana-program-error = "3.0.0" solana-pubkey = { version = "2.2.1", features = ["curve25519"] } spl-discriminator = { version = "0.4.0", path = "../discriminator" } spl-program-error = { version = "0.7.0", path = "../program-error" } diff --git a/type-length-value/Cargo.toml b/type-length-value/Cargo.toml index 7f5f9404..9dd98d09 100644 --- a/type-length-value/Cargo.toml +++ b/type-length-value/Cargo.toml @@ -19,7 +19,7 @@ num-traits = "0.2" solana-account-info = "2.2.1" solana-decode-error = "2.2.1" solana-msg = "3.0.0" -solana-program-error = "2.2.2" +solana-program-error = "3.0.0" spl-discriminator = { version = "0.4.0", path = "../discriminator" } spl-type-length-value-derive = { version = "0.2", path = "./derive", optional = true } spl-pod = { version = "0.6.0", path = "../pod" }